Understanding the Risk Curve
The core element of this game is the ever-increasing multiplier. As the airplane's flight continues, the multiplier grows exponentially. The longer you wait to cash out, the larger the potential payout, but the higher the risk of the plane departing. This creates a constantly shifting risk curve. Early cash-outs guarantee a small profit, while later cash-outs offer the possibility of substantial rewards, but with a drastically reduced probability of success. Mastering the art of reading this curve is paramount. Players need to internalize the relationship between time, multiplier, and probability to make informed decisions.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ement and chase increasingly higher multipliers, but the statistically prudent approach involves accepting smaller, more frequent wins.
Different platforms may offer slight variations in how the multiplier is generated, but the fundamental principle remains consistent. Many employ a provably fair system, leveraging cryptographic algorithms to ensure transparency and eliminate any suspicion of manipulation. This adds a layer of trust for players who are concerned about the fairness of the game. However, even with a provably fair system, the inherent randomness means that outcomes are unpredictable, and losses are always a possibility. A sound risk management strategy is thus essential for mitigating potential downsides.

Analyzing Statistical Trends
While each round is inherently random, some players attempt to identify statistical patterns in the game’s history. They analyze the multipliers achieved in previous rounds, looking for sequences or trends that might suggest when the plane is more or less likely to crash. For example, some believe that after a series of low multipliers, a higher multiplier is more probable. However, it's important to remember that past performance is not indicative of future results. The game is designed to be unpredictable, and any perceived patterns are likely due to chance. Relying solely on statistical analysis can be misleading and lead to poor decision-making. Still, observing the game's history can provide a better understanding of the range of possible outcomes and the average multiplier achieved over time.
Sophisticated players often employ charting tools and statistical software to analyze large datasets of game results. These tools can help identify potential biases or irregularities in the random number generator, but it's crucial to interpret the data cautiously. The vast majority of variations will be within the expected range of randomness. It's more productive to focus on mastering risk management techniques and developing a consistent betting strategy than attempting to predict the unpredictable.

The Psychology of the Aviator Game
The appeal of the aviator game extends beyond the simple mechanics of risk and reward. The psychological factors at play are significant. The visual representation of the airplane's ascent creates a sense of anticipation and excitement. The increasing multiplier triggers a dopamine rush, reinforcing the desire to continue playing. However, this can also lead to irrational behavior, such as chasing losses or betting beyond your means. Players often fall victim to the “near miss” effect, where they feel compelled to continue playing after narrowly avoiding a loss, believing that a win is just around the corner. Understanding these psychological biases is crucial for maintaining objectivity and making rational decisions.
The game's design intentionally exploits these psychological vulnerabilities. The fast-paced nature of the gameplay and the constant stream of visual stimuli contribute to a state of heightened arousal, making it more difficult to think clearly and exercise self-control. Successful players are those who can recognize and counteract these psychological effects, maintaining a disciplined approach even in the face of temptation. Taking breaks, setting limits, and practicing mindful gambling can all help to mitigate the negative psychological consequences of playing.
